THE QUETZALS BIBLE AND BEGINNERS' HANDBOOK A Comprehensive Guide to Quetzal Biology and Habitat Needs - Feeding Ecology, Nesting Behavior, Habitat Conservation, Species Identification, Breeding, and More By RITA K.O KARL Quetzals are among the most spectacular and mysterious birds in the world. Famous for their brilliant emerald-green plumage, long flowing tail feathers, and deep cultural significance in Central America, these rare forest birds have fascinated naturalists, researchers, and wildlife enthusiasts for centuries. The Quetzals Bible and Beginners' Handbook provides a detailed exploration of the biology, behavior, and ecological importance of these extraordinary birds. Designed for bird lovers, wildlife students, and nature enthusiasts, this book offers a clear and engaging introduction to the life of quetzals in their natural cloud forest habitats. Inside this guide, readers will learn how quetzals survive in the dense mountain forests of Central and South America, how they locate food, and how their feeding ecology shapes the forest ecosystems they inhabit. The book explains their fruit-based diet, their role as seed dispersers, and the remarkable adaptations that allow them to thrive in high-altitude environments. This handbook also explores quetzal nesting habits, courtship displays, and breeding behavior, providing insights into how these birds reproduce and raise their young in secluded forest cavities. In addition, the guide introduces different quetzal species and highlights the environmental challenges they face due to habitat loss and changing ecosystems. Written in a clear and accessible style, this book combines scientific understanding with practical explanations, making it an ideal resource for anyone interested in tropical birds, ornithology, and wildlife conservation. Inside this book, you will learn: The biology and physical characteristics of quetzals Species identification and distinguishing features Feeding ecology and fruit-based diet Nesting behavior and breeding strategies Courtship displays and parental care Habitat requirements in tropical cloud forests The ecological importance of quetzals as seed dispersers Conservation challenges and protection efforts If you are fascinated by tropical birds and want to understand one of the most iconic species of the rainforest, this handbook offers an insightful and comprehensive guide to the world of quetzals.
